Termite Inspection Service in Katy, TX
Termite inspection services involve a thorough assessment of a property to identify the presence of termites or any signs of infestations. These inspections typically cover both interior and exterior areas, including basements, crawl spaces, attics, and wooden structures, to detect potential damage or conditions that attract termites. Homeowners often request inspections when purchasing a new property, noticing signs of wood damage, or scheduling routine evaluations to prevent costly repairs. Understanding what the inspection entails and what areas are examined can help property owners prepare for the process and ensure all potential issues are identified early.

Termite Inspection Service Questions
What is involved in a termite inspection? A termite inspection includes a thorough examination of the property’s foundation, walls, and accessible wood structures to identify signs of termite activity or damage.
How often should a property be inspected for termites? Regular inspections are recommended at least once a year to detect any early signs of infestation and prevent extensive damage.
What signs indicate a possible termite problem? Indicators include mud tubes on exterior walls, discarded wings near windows, and damaged or hollow-sounding wood structures.
Why is a professional termite inspection important? Professional inspections provide a detailed assessment, helping to identify issues early and determine appropriate treatment options.
